What is the secret of Chinese skin?

Chinese Women use rice water to tone their skin and to enhance it's complexion. Just soak unpolished rice in a bowl of water and stir it well, until the water becomes milky white. Store this water in a refrigerator and use the water as a toner with a cotton pad. This is just wonderful and quite cheap.

Does rice whiten skin?

Rice water for skin lightening

Many websites recommend using rice water to lighten the skin or reduce dark patches. In fact, a lot of commercial products — including soaps, toners, and creams — contain rice water. Some people swear by the skin lightening powers of rice water.

Why do Chinese drink hot water?

Under the precepts of Chinese medicine, balance is key, and hot or warm water is considered essential to balance cold and humidity; in addition, it is believed to promote blood circulation and toxin release.

How do Japanese whiten their skin?

Lightening methods

The popular method of bihaku is to use cosmetics that stop the production of melanin. Traditionally, uguisu no fun was used to lighten skin tone, although today it is considered a luxury item. The most popular products often contain sake and rice bran, which contain kojic acid.
